NOTE: Goldman’s book chronicles the 1998 assassination of Guatemalan bishop and human rights activist, Msgr. Juan Gerardi, including the investigation of the crime and the trial that brought to justice two of those involved in the killing. It was recently reviewed in the New York Times Review of Books, Washington Post Book World and the New Yorker.

This event is sponsored by Georgetown Law’s Center for the Advancement of the Rule of Law in the Americas (CAROLA) and Human Rights Institute.
